Applicants sought for vacancy on watershed board

The Hennepin County Board is seeking applicants for a vacancy on the Riley-Purgatory-Bluff Creek Watershed District Board, due to the resignation of Erin Ahola.

The unexpired term for the vacancy ends July 31, 2008.

This board coordinates management of water and related land resources within the areas generally tributary to Riley, Purgatory and Bluff creeks in southwest Hennepin and northeast Carver counties. A member may not be a public officer of the county, state or federal government and must be a resident of the district, which in Hennepin County includes portions of Bloomington, Eden Prairie, Minnetonka, Deephaven and Shorewood.

Because of the nature of the board, it is helpful for members to have a background in water conservation, development, law, engineering, environment or public administration. Members serve three-year terms.

Deadline for applications is Sept. 6, with interviews to be held at the General Government Committee meeting Sept. 11, and appointment Sept. 18.
